Diazepam 10 mg/Gm Vaginal Gel

Diazepam 10mg/gm Vaginal Gel is a prescription medication used for the treatment of Vulvodynia, a condition characterized by chronic vulvar discomfort or pain in women. This gel contains diazepam, which belongs to a class of drugs called benzodiazepines. It acts on the central nervous system and may help reduce muscle spasms, which are thought to cause the pain associated with Vulvodynia. It is applied directly to the affected area of the vulva and absorbed through the skin to provide local relief.

How Does it Work

Diazepam 10 mg/Gm Vaginal Gel is an effective treatment for Women’s Health - Vulvodynia. The gel is applied intravaginally and is thought to work by inhibiting the conduction of afferent neural signals from the vulva, which can lead to a decrease in the pain experienced by patients. The gel also has an anti-inflammatory effect which can help alleviate discomfort and inflammation associated with the condition. The advantage of this particular formulation is that it provides a slow and continuous release of diazepam, leading to a sustained therapeutic effect. Furthermore, the gel has a very low systemic absorption rate, which minimizes the risk of unwanted side effects. It is important to note that the effectiveness of the gel can vary from patient to patient and that it is best used in conjunction with other treatments such as psychotherapy, lifestyle changes and medication. Other Uses

Diazepam 10 mg/Gm Vaginal Gel may be an effective treatment for muscle spasms in patients who cannot take oral medications. The diazepam could be used to reduce muscle spasms resulting from musculoskeletal conditions of the pelvic area, such as for piriformis syndrome or nerve entrapment neuropathy. Additionally, the medication could be beneficial for other conditions involving spasticity or increased muscle tone resulting from strokes, traumatic brain injuries, or multiple sclerosis. The vaginal delivery of diazepam 10 mg/Gm Vaginal Gel bypasses the digestive system and is absorbed directly, providing more rapid relief than if administered orally. The compounded formulation also has potential to reduce local pain and inflammation associated with these conditions, as well as potentially reduce psychological stress and anxiety.
